Phoenix Valley Cultural Center looks to Renkus-Heinz for flexible sound solution

CHINA: The Phoenix Valley Cultural Center in Changzhou’s Wujin District, China, has been enhanced with addition of a Renkus-Heinz line array sound system. The design and installation was performed by Shanghai LeDan Audio Equipment Co Ltd.

Situated on a busy thoroughfare, the centre spans more than 15,000 sq-m, and is home to four cinemas, sports and dance halls, as well as a retail hub, children's playgrounds, and a public square with canals and gardens.

The complex’s crown jewel, the Grand Theatre, seats just over 1,000 people across two floors. The venue hosts a wide range of events, from musicals to theatre, with 17 projectors transforming the stage into an Omni-Max style theatre.

Audio for the theatre needed to be able to accommodate a variety of events, from drama, live shows and TV, to meetings, conferences and multi-media reporting. The system designed by Shanghai LeDan Audio Equipment comprises of left, right, and centre hangs, composed of 14 Renkus-Heinz STLA/9 line array loudspeakers. Eight SGX41 4-inch loudspeakers were mounted on the orchestra rail as front fills, with six TRX81 providing rear fill, and four DRS18-2B subwoofers adding low end reinforcement. Stage monitoring is catered for with a combination of PNX151T, TRX121/9, and CF81 cabinets.

For cinema presentations, a surround system was installed. This is comprised of 20 TRX81/12 speakers, alongside three STX7/64 cabinets mounted on top. On stage effects have been provided by a single STX5M2 speaker and STX5 subwoofer.

Adjacent to the Grand Theatre is the Small Theatre, a 200-seat auditorium designed for meetings, multimedia conferences, and small performances. The installation team opted for left and right arrays composed of three STX4 cabinets, with four CFX81 boxes for front fill and a pair of DRS18-2B subs.
